The board approved the meeting agenda, the consent agenda, and policies 113, 414, 415, 533 and 806 by voice vote and then voted to move into a closed session under Minnesota Statutes to discuss labor negotiations with multiple teacher bargaining units.

The Edina Public Schools Board of Education approved the meeting agenda, the consent agenda and five district policies during its Aug. 11 regular meeting and then voted to move into closed session to discuss labor negotiations.
